Hg scheme 1
Notes
Efficiency: 0.1%
Used at: CERN
Lasers used: Dye
Reference: B. Marsh, V. Fedosseev, "RILIS Database" (2009)
Notes: From literature review it seems more likely the used 2nd excited state was 71333.053cm-1 (1D2). In Podshivalov et al. (1999), this is given as the most intense.
Scheme
Ionization Potential: 84184.150 cm⁻¹ (NIST ASD, 2024)
Lasers used: Dye
Scheme table
| Step | λ (nm) | From (cm⁻¹) | Term | To (cm⁻¹) | Term | Strength (s⁻¹) |
|---|---|---|---|---|---|---|
| 1 | 253.728 | 0.000 | 6s2 1S0 | 39412.237 | 6s 6p 3P1 | 1.4 × 107 |
| 2 | 312.658 | 39412.237 | 6s 6p 3P1 | 71396.073 | 6s 6d 3D2 | 6.6 × 107 |
| 3 | 627.989 | 71396.073 | 6s 6d 3D2 | 87319.928 | AI |
